What Is a Cellular Mechanic? An Outline of On-Site Vehicle Repair Services

Definition and How Cell Mechanics Work

A mobile mechanic is a qualified automotive technician who brings the storage to you. As An Alternative of driving your automobile to a repair shop in Burnaby, Vancouver, or any of the encircling Lower Mainland cities, a cell mechanic involves your house, office, or even the roadside to perform maintenance and repairs. They're equipped with a cellular workshop containing the mandatory instruments and components to deal with a extensive range of automotive points. This convenient service is reworking how people entry vehicle maintenance and repair.

The process is simple. You contact a cell mechanic, describe the problem, and schedule an appointment. On the appointed day, the mechanic arrives, diagnoses the difficulty, and discusses repair choices with you. Once you approve the work, they perform the repairs on-site, usually using advanced diagnostic tools to pinpoint issues shortly and effectively. Following the repair, they'll give you an bill and explain any needed ongoing maintenance.

Limitations and When to Go To a Garage

While cellular mechanics supply unimaginable comfort, there are limitations. Major repairs or those requiring specialized equipment would possibly necessitate a go to to a standard storage. Complex engine overhauls or intensive bodywork are usually better suited to a totally equipped shop. A cellular mechanic will doubtless advise you accordingly. It's necessary to discuss the scope of the work upfront.

Similarly, sure repairs might want specific diagnostic tools not available in a mobile unit. In such cases, a conventional garage with its complete assets is extra acceptable. Transparency and open communication between you and the mobile mechanic are essential for figuring out the most effective course of action.

Questions to Ask Earlier Than Booking (Pricing, Guarantees, Insurance)

Before booking an appointment, ask about their pricing construction. Are there hourly charges or flat fees? Do they offer upfront quotes? It's essential to know the prices involved beforehand to forestall sudden expenses. Guarantee you get a detailed breakdown of the repair costs to remove any ambiguity.

Inquire about their ensures and guarantee policies. What is their coverage on components and labor? A reputable cellular mechanic will offer an inexpensive warranty on their work and parts used. Lastly, always confirm their insurance coverage coverage; this protects you in case of unintended damage in the course of the repair process. Don't start the work until you're absolutely comfy with all elements of the settlement.

What Companies Can a Cellular Mechanic Provide?

Basic Maintenance (Oil Changes, Tire Rotations, Fluid Checks)

Mobile mechanics handle the important routine maintenance tasks essential to hold your car in prime situation. This consists of timely oil modifications utilizing the beneficial grade in your car. Regular oil changes forestall engine wear and tear, extending the lifespan of your engine and stopping pricey repairs in the future.

Tire rotations are another common service. Rotating tires ensures even put on throughout all tires, bettering fuel efficiency and handling. Cell mechanics additionally carry out fluid checks, monitoring coolant levels, brake fluid, transmission fluid, and energy steering fluid, alerting you to potential points early on.

Repairs (Brake Work, Battery Replacement, Engine Diagnostics)

Beyond routine maintenance, cellular mechanics deal with a spread of repairs. Brake work, together with brake pad substitute, is a important service they supply. They can diagnose and repair brake points, making certain the protection and reliability of your braking system. Lifeless batteries are one other widespread problem; cellular mechanics are outfitted to switch batteries efficiently.

Engine diagnostics are an necessary part of their providers. Utilizing advanced diagnostic tools, cell mechanics can determine engine issues, allowing for well timed repairs and stopping extra extensive problems down the line. This proactive strategy to automobile maintenance can save you important bills.
